Physical properties
Hardness: 7 on Mohs scale; Color: Brown to nearly black; Luster: Vitreous (glassy); Crystal Structure: Trigonal; Cleavage: None, exhibits conchoidal fracture; Specific Gravity: 2.65
Formation & geological history
Formed in igneous, metamorphic, and hydrothermal environments through the natural irradiation of crystalline quartz containing trace amounts of aluminum impurities. Found worldwide in pegmatites and veins.
Uses & applications
Used in jewelry, decorative items, and metaphysical practices. Also utilized in industrial applications requiring high purity silica.
Geological facts
Smoky quartz is the national gemstone of Scotland. Its distinctive color is caused by natural gamma radiation from surrounding radioactive rocks acting on aluminum impurities within the quartz lattice.
Field identification & locations
Easily identified by its translucent to opaque brown coloration and characteristic conchoidal fracture with vitreous luster. Commonly found in pegmatites and alluvial deposits globally.
